Bronzer, camouflage and SPF in one.

Mineral sunscreen for men - SPF 18
Discrete coverage for blotchiness, redness and rosacea
Gentle on sensitive skin
Washes off easily without soap

Active ingredients: 
Titanium Dioxide(CI 77891) 14%,Zinc Oxide(CI 77947) 3%.
Ingredients: 
Mica(CI 77019), Bismuth Oxychioride (CI 77163),Dimethicone, Boron Nitride,Stearic Acid,Hydrated Silica, Pinus Strobus (Pine) Bark Extract, Melaleuca Alternifolia (Tea Tree) Extract. May Contain: Iron Oxides (CI 77489, CI 77491, CI 77492, CI 77499),Ultramarines(CI 77007),Carmine(CI 75470).

H\E Bronzer is a great mineral bronzer. I use it primarily because it has SPF 18. At around $40, it does cost more than most facial sunscreens, but I think it's worth it because most sunscreens cause me to break out (even the ones that are just facial moisturizers with SPF.)

Be very careful about picking a shade that is too dark. (There are five shades, where 1 is the lightest and 5 is the darkest.) I got a sampler of the HE Bronzer and used shade #3, and the contrast between my neck and my face was so stark that my friends made fun of me for hours. Now I'll only use shade #1, even in the summer.
